    • They are Muscovy ducks – raised for food, though these are are two of our hens and one of our drakes (the one with his bill open) from our breeding flock. They obviously come in a wide variety of colors and patterns. You can read more about them if you click on the “Ducks” tab at the top. We really enjoy them – quiet, smart, free-ranging, prolific breeders, and wonderful mothers.
